Hong Kong’s only trash incinerator struggles to cope with vast amounts of Covid medical waste

Views 46

Hong Kong’s only waste incinerator is struggling to deal with vast amounts of medical waste generated by the city’s fifth wave of Covid-19. Daily medical waste levels are said to be twice that of the incinerator’s capacity. From March 19-23, 2022, the city generated over three times more clinical waste each day , compared to the same period in 2021, according to the city’s Environmental Protection Department.
